More about the book

The story centers on sisters Juts and Wheezie Hunsenmeir, along with Juts's insightful daughter, Nickel, as they navigate the challenges of a profound loss that reshapes their lives. Through their journey, the narrative explores themes of resilience, family bonds, and the impact of grief, highlighting the strength of their relationships amidst adversity.
